news 2026/5/30 21:20:43

3分钟解锁加密音乐:打破平台限制的音乐自由解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3分钟解锁加密音乐:打破平台限制的音乐自由解决方案

3分钟解锁加密音乐:打破平台限制的音乐自由解决方案

【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music

你是否曾在QQ音乐下载了心爱的歌曲,却无法在车载音响上播放?或者从网易云音乐保存了珍贵的歌单,却发现只能在特定APP里欣赏?你的音乐被平台加密格式"锁住"了,而Unlock Music正是为你解决这一痛点的完美工具。这款浏览器音乐解锁工具让你在3分钟内就能将加密音乐转换为通用格式,实现真正的音乐自由。作为一款完全免费的开源项目,它让加密音乐文件转换变得简单快捷,无论你是普通用户还是技术爱好者,都能轻松上手。

你的音乐为什么被"困住"了?

想象一下这样的场景:你在不同音乐平台收藏了数百首歌曲,想在健身房的音响、车载系统或朋友的设备上播放时,却遭遇格式不兼容的尴尬。各大平台为了保护版权,采用了各自的加密技术:

  • QQ音乐的.qmc系列格式
  • 网易云音乐的.ncm加密
  • 酷狗音乐的.kgm格式
  • 酷我音乐的.kwm格式
  • 虾米音乐的.xm格式

这些加密措施本意是保护版权,却无意中限制了你的音乐体验。Unlock Music的出现,就是要打破这些技术壁垒,让你的音乐真正属于你。

核心理念:让音乐回归自由

Unlock Music的核心价值很简单:你的音乐,你做主。这个项目基于一个朴素的理念——用户对自己购买或下载的音乐应该拥有完全的使用权。它不提倡盗版,而是帮助用户合法地管理自己的音乐库。

与其他工具不同,Unlock Music的所有处理都在你的浏览器中完成:

  • 零数据上传:你的音乐文件永远不会离开你的设备
  • 完全隐私保护:无需担心音乐内容被第三方获取
  • 开源透明:所有代码公开可查,没有隐藏功能

项目的核心解密模块位于src/decrypt/目录,每个音乐平台都有对应的解密算法。WebAssembly技术让解密过程高效快速,即使处理大量文件也能保持流畅体验。

实际效果:从困扰到自由的转变

让我分享几个真实的使用场景:

场景一:车载音乐爱好者的重生王先生有500多首从不同平台下载的歌曲,但他的车载音响只支持标准格式。使用Unlock Music后,他花了一个下午将所有歌曲转换为MP3格式,现在他的爱车变成了移动音乐厅,每次出行都是享受。

场景二:音乐教师的素材库整理李老师需要从各个平台收集教学素材,但不同格式让她头疼不已。通过Unlock Music,她统一了所有音频格式,建立了规范的教学素材库,备课效率提升了50%。

场景三:健身达人的运动伴侣小张喜欢在健身房听音乐,但健身房的音响系统不支持加密格式。现在他可以将任何平台的音乐转换为通用格式,打造个性化的健身歌单,让每次训练都充满动力。

三步轻松上手:零技术门槛的操作指南

第一步:获取工具(选择最适合你的方式)

在线使用(最简单): 直接在浏览器中打开Unlock Music的在线版本,无需任何安装,即开即用。

本地部署(最推荐): 如果你注重隐私或需要处理大量文件,本地部署是最佳选择:

git clone https://gitcode.com/gh_mirrors/un/unlock-music cd unlock-music npm ci npm run build npm run serve

部署完成后,访问http://localhost:8080即可开始使用。这种方式处理速度更快,且完全离线工作。

第二步:拖放文件,智能识别

将加密的音乐文件直接拖拽到浏览器窗口中,Unlock Music会自动:

  1. 识别文件格式和来源平台
  2. 应用对应的解密算法
  3. 保留原始音质和元数据

支持批量处理,你可以一次性拖入多个文件,系统会自动排队处理。

第三步:下载和整理

解密完成后,你可以:

  • 单曲下载或批量下载所有文件
  • 编辑歌曲的元数据(标题、艺术家、专辑等)
  • 添加或替换专辑封面
  • 统一命名格式,方便管理

进阶技巧:让音乐管理更高效

浏览器扩展:一键解锁

对于频繁使用的用户,可以构建浏览器扩展版本:

npm run make-extension

安装扩展后,你可以在文件管理器中右键点击加密音乐文件,选择"用Unlock Music解密",实现一键转换。

批量处理的最佳实践

处理大量文件时,这些小技巧能帮你事半功倍:

  1. 按平台分类:将QQ音乐、网易云音乐等不同来源的文件分开处理
  2. 分批操作:每次处理50-100个文件,避免浏览器内存压力
  3. 命名规范:使用"艺术家-歌曲名"的格式,方便后续管理
  4. 元数据检查:解密后花几分钟检查并完善歌曲信息

专业用户的深度玩法

如果你是开发者或技术爱好者,可以:

  • 研究src/QmcWasm/src/KgmWasm/目录中的WebAssembly解密核心
  • 查看src/decrypt/下的各种解密算法实现
  • 参与项目开发,贡献新的解密方案
  • 基于项目代码开发自己的音乐管理工具

常见问题解答:你的疑虑我来解

Q:解密后的音质会下降吗?A:完全不会!Unlock Music只是移除加密层,不会对音频数据进行任何压缩或修改,音质与原始文件完全相同。

Q:处理大量文件时速度慢怎么办?A:建议分批处理,每次50-100个文件。同时确保浏览器有足够的内存,关闭不必要的标签页。

Q:某些文件解密失败怎么办?A:首先确认文件是否完整下载,然后检查是否为支持的格式。如果问题持续,可以查看项目文档或在社区寻求帮助。

Q:元数据丢失了如何恢复?A:Unlock Music会尽量保留原始元数据。如果仍有缺失,可以使用音乐标签编辑器手动添加,或从音乐数据库自动匹配。

Q:这个工具安全吗?A:绝对安全!所有处理都在你的浏览器中完成,文件不会上传到任何服务器。项目完全开源,代码可审计。

加入社区:一起推动音乐自由

Unlock Music不仅是一个工具,更是一个活跃的开源社区。你可以通过以下方式参与:

  1. 反馈问题:在使用中遇到任何问题,都可以在项目仓库提交Issue
  2. 贡献代码:如果你有技术能力,可以参与解密算法的改进或新功能的开发
  3. 分享经验:将你的使用经验写成教程,帮助更多用户
  4. 翻译文档:帮助将项目文档翻译成更多语言

项目的完整文档位于README.md,开发指南和贡献规范可以在项目文件中找到。每个解密模块都有详细的测试用例,位于src/decrypt/__test__/目录,方便开发者理解和验证。

现在就开始你的音乐自由之旅

不要再让平台限制你的音乐体验。无论你是想:

  • 在车载音响上播放QQ音乐下载的歌曲
  • 将网易云音乐歌单导入本地播放器
  • 整理来自多个平台的音乐收藏
  • 为音乐制作准备素材

Unlock Music都能帮你轻松实现。记住,技术应该让生活更美好,而不是制造障碍。现在就打开浏览器,开始解锁属于你的音乐自由吧!

每一次解密,都是对音乐自由的重新定义;每一次转换,都是对个人权利的坚定主张。你的音乐,应该在任何设备、任何时间、任何地点都能自由播放——这就是Unlock Music给你的承诺。

【免费下载链接】unlock-music在浏览器中解锁加密的音乐文件。原仓库: 1. https://github.com/unlock-music/unlock-music ;2. https://git.unlock-music.dev/um/web项目地址: https://gitcode.com/gh_mirrors/un/unlock-music

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/30 21:16:42

Apache Gravitino:构建高性能地理分布式元数据湖的统一治理平台

Apache Gravitino:构建高性能地理分布式元数据湖的统一治理平台 【免费下载链接】gravitino Worlds most powerful open data catalog for building a high-performance, geo-distributed and federated metadata lake. 项目地址: https://gitcode.com/GitHub_Tre…

作者头像 李华
网站建设 2026/5/30 21:10:19

如何一键免费实现B站视频AI智能总结,3分钟掌握2小时内容精华

如何一键免费实现B站视频AI智能总结,3分钟掌握2小时内容精华 【免费下载链接】BiliTools A cross-platform bilibili toolbox. 跨平台哔哩哔哩工具箱,支持下载视频、番剧等等各类资源 项目地址: https://gitcode.com/GitHub_Trending/bilit/BiliTools …

作者头像 李华
网站建设 2026/5/30 21:09:27

Linux 默认 SUID 可执行文件详解

在 Linux 权限体系中,SUID(Set User ID)是一种特殊权限位。当一个程序被设置了 SUID 位后,任何用户执行该程序时,程序都会以文件所有者的身份运行,而非执行者的身份。这一机制是许多系统功能正常运作的基础…

作者头像 李华
网站建设 2026/5/30 21:04:21

用Ovito 3.6.0免费版搞定晶界与点缺陷的可视化:一个材料模拟后处理的保姆级避坑指南

用Ovito 3.6.0免费版实现晶界与缺陷可视化:科研小白的低成本解决方案作为一名经常需要处理分子动力学模拟数据的材料研究者,我深知专业软件授权费用对预算有限的科研人员意味着什么。Ovito作为一款功能强大的材料模拟可视化工具,其Pro版固然功…

作者头像 李华